Newcastle United could face a battle with Spanish giants Real Madrid for midfielder Boubakary Soumaré this summer.

Sport explain that one of the priorities for Real boss Zinedine Zidane this summer is to strengthen the midfield and, alongside Paul Pogba has identified Eduardo Camavinga, Soumaré and a third, unnamed player.

Both players are highly-rated in Ligue 1 and subsequently have suitors lining up to take them away in the near future.

Soumaré was the subject of a bid from Newcastle in the January transfer window but turned the opportunity down, later admitting he wanted to join a bigger club.

Sport say he remains a target for Premier League clubs and that Newcastle have not ‘thrown in the towel’ yet. Lille, however, have not accepted any offers.

Madrid have not presented a bid as yet, but Zidane is said to have been following the midfielder for a long time and has received ‘very good reports’ about him.

While Newcastle haven’t given up, it’s extremely unlikely Soumaré will have changed his mind on the club since the January transfer window.

Nonetheless, Magpies fans will be encouraged by the fact the club are seemingly showing plenty of ambition in their transfer targets.
